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Greet potential residents, provide information and show apartments available for rent. 
  • Attend and assist in the coordination and organization of resident relations and activities.
  • Maintain accurate and in-depth knowledge of the community, particularly in areas such as rent and pricing, vacancies, apartment availability, lease expirations, etc.
  • Answer and follow up on all telephone and on-site traffic, in accordance with company policy and all Fair Housing Laws.
  • Complete a “Guest Card”; obtain a completed and legible “Rental Application” from prospective residents.
  • Forward completed application materials to the screening company.
  • Refer prospects to other Princeton properties as needed.
  • Upon prospects approval, execute and complete all applicable paperwork and processes.
  • Complete reporting and enter traffic daily as required.
  • Ensure curb appeal and community appearance as assigned.
  • Complete Market Surveys on a quarterly basis.
  • Maintain current and correct property files and records.
  • Maintain a clean and organized workspace.
  • Collect monies, fees, or any other amounts owed, and bank daily.
  • Accompany vendors and contractors to resident apartments as needed.
  • Assist the Community Manager in completing all turnover processes.
  • Any and all other duties as required by your supervisor.
